HP OfficeJet 150 Mobile Ink Cartridges FAQs

  • How long do HP OfficeJet 150 Mobile Ink Cartridges typically last?

    The lifespan of ink cartridges varies depending on usage, but on average, they can last for 200-300 pages for black ink and 150-200 pages for color ink.

  • Are these ink cartridges compatible with other HP printers?

    These cartridges are specifically designed for the HP OfficeJet 150 Mobile printer. They may be compatible with some other HP models, but it's best to check your printer's specifications.

  • Can I use third-party ink cartridges in my HP OfficeJet 150 Mobile printer?

    While third-party cartridges may work, using genuine HP cartridges ensures the best print quality and helps maintain your printer's warranty.

  • How do I install new ink cartridges in my HP OfficeJet 150 Mobile printer?

    Open the ink cartridge access door, remove the old cartridge, insert the new one until it clicks into place, and close the door. The printer will automatically align the new cartridge.

  • What's the difference between the HP C8766WN and C9363WN Tricolor Ink Cartridges?

    The C9363WN typically has a higher page yield and may be more suitable for users who print frequently or in large volumes.

  • How can I tell if my ink cartridge is running low?

    Your printer will display a low ink warning on its control panel. You can also check ink levels through the printer software on your computer.

  • Are these ink cartridges recyclable?

    Yes, HP offers a free recycling program for used ink cartridges. You can return them to HP or drop them off at participating retail locations.

  • Can I refill these ink cartridges myself?

    While it's possible to refill cartridges, it's not recommended as it may affect print quality and potentially damage your printer. It's best to use new, genuine HP cartridges.

  • How should I store unused ink cartridges?

    Store cartridges in their original packaging at room temperature. Avoid extreme temperatures and direct sunlight to maintain their quality.

  • What should I do if my printer doesn't recognize the new ink cartridge?

    Try removing and reinserting the cartridge. If the issue persists, clean the cartridge contacts and try again. If problems continue, contact HP support for assistance.
